Como Pool Path Stage 2 – Detail Design and Construction, Como
Sutherland Shire Council

The Como Pool Path site is set along the waterfront bounded by the Como Swimming Pool, tidal baths, café and sandstone seawall, at arguably one of the Sutherland Shire’s most spectacular outlooks!

The much-needed upgrade to the rundown path included mass demolition of paving and concrete paths, earthworks, decommissioning of two stair access ways (that no longer met code), whist ensuring the heritage listed sandstone seawall remained intact.

Unpredictable weather made for a challenging worksite that included drainage works, concrete paving, rendering, construction of stairs and stone wall to match the existing heritage listed seawall, construction and installation of aluminium balustrade and handrails to seawall edge, stairs and ramps, together with the installation of street furniture including new shower, seating and planting.

This magnificent and culturally significant site within the Como Pleasure Grounds, with panoramic views of the Georges River and surrounding bushlands, can be enjoyed all year round with thanks to Sutherland Shire Council and the team at Growth Civil Landscapes!
